Boulder City Hospital is seeking a detail-oriented and reliable Insurance Verifier to join our team. This role is responsible for verifying patient insurance coverage, confirming benefits, and obtaining necessary authorizations for scheduled and unscheduled services. The ideal candidate will have strong organizational skills, the ability to multitask, and a solid understanding of insurance processes within a healthcare setting.
General Purpose:
The Insurance Verification Recorder is responsible for verifying insurance, benefits, and obtaining authorizations for patients presenting for services when advance registration notification has not been received for non-emergency services. For emergency services, authorizations are obtained as soon as possible in accordance with individual insurance requirements and hospital policy.
Key Responsibilities:
Verify patient insurance eligibility and benefits accurately and efficiently Obtain prior authorizations for procedures and services as required Ensure compliance with insurance company guidelines and hospital policies Communicate with insurance providers, patients, and internal departments regarding coverage and authorization status Document all verification and authorization activities in the appropriate systems Assist with resolving insurance-related issues prior to service delivery
